Starring role for Diana Rigg

22 Jun 2007


Dame Diana Rigg is to star in the stage version of the Pedro Almodovar film All About My Mother. Lesley Manville has also been cast in the play, which has its world premiere later this year at London's Old Vic theatre.

The Avengers legend Rigg, 68, will play Huma Rojo, a famous actress, in the production. Manville, 51, famous for her roles in Mike Leigh films such as Secrets And Lies and Topsy-Turvy, stars as Manuela, who embarks on a life-changing trip to Barcelona following the tragic death of her son.

Joanne Froggatt has the role of Sister Rosa, a young nun in search of love, who was played by Penelope Cruz in the film.

Froggatt, 27, came to prominence as Zoe Tattersall in Coronation Street and has since starred as Joanne Lees in TV dramas Murder In The Outback and Myra Hindley's sister in See No Evil: The Moors Murders.

This is the first time Almodovar has agreed to his work being produced in English for the theatre. The Spanish director said of Rigg, also famous for playing Tracy in the Bond film On Her Majesty's Secret Service: "I have been a fan of Diana's for all these years and I am thrilled that she is playing Huma."

Colin Morgan, currently making his West End debut in the lead role of Vernon God Little at The Young Vic, will feature as Manuela's son, Esteban, and Charlotte Randle, who appeared in the West End production of Don Carlos, will play Nina.

Old Vic artistic director and American Beauty star Kevin Spacey said: "I'm thrilled about the casting to date. The Old Vic celebrates exceptional acting talent and all five of these actors bring unique qualities that we believe will bring this amazing story to life for our audience."

"I've always been a huge admirer of Lesley Manville's work and her remarkable ability to access truth and humanity in the roles she plays.
"Her extensive experience of working on new writing with Mike Leigh, at the Royal Court and elsewhere, makes her a wonderful asset to this
production."

"I couldn't be more pleased that Diana Rigg, one of the UK's best-loved actresses, will be playing the role of Huma. Diana's played an extraordinary range of roles in a distinguished career and I can't wait to see her on The Old Vic stage."

All About My Mother (1999) won an Oscar, Bafta and Golden Globe for best foreign language film and the Palme d'Or for best director at the Cannes Film Festival. Performances begin on August 25.
